Construction of Steps
To create steps, the Celtik Step System will make your job
easier and faster, this system is composed of steps and concrete
risers giving stability to the unit.
The first thing to do is establish how many steps you’ll
need.
Each step including the riser and the Capping measures 180 mm
or 7 inches.
Bury the first concrete block so that it sits
flush with the ground, use a Celtik block or a 4 inch or 10 cm
solid concrete block.
Install the concrete riser.
Fill in the back of the riser with crushed
0-3/4 inch or 0-20mm stone and compact with a jumping jack or
vibrating plate.
Spread concrete adhesive.
Lay down a Celtik Step Capping Module over it.
Lay down a 2 or 4 inch or a 5 or 10cm solid concrete block or
a Celtik Block.
Make sure its level. Fill in the back of the block and
compact.
Install the second Celtik riser and repeat the stage of
filling and compacting.
Add a second Celtik Step Capping module, repeat these
operations until you reach the desired height.
If you’re planning to build a wall on one or both sides of
the steps, we recommend you build a vertical wall to facilitate
the installation of the steps. This will give you a fantastic
finish.
